Objectives

Recall the essential principles of culturally relevant curriculum and acknowledge their potential impact on both educators and students. Grasp the significance of embedding cultural diversity within the curriculum and how it fosters a more comprehensive learning environment. Apply the pedagogical strategies provided to adapt your existing curriculum and weave cultural relevance into your teaching approach. Evaluate and compare various resources introduced during the workshop, considering their suitability for diverse teaching scenarios. Craft a personalized culturally relevant lesson plan aimed at deepening students' understanding while achieving educational objectives. Assess your transformed curriculum's effectiveness in student engagement, participation, and cultural awareness.
